Home automation systems in Los Angeles range from $1,000 for basic smart lighting and thermostats to over $15,000 for comprehensive whole-home solutions. Professional installation labor costs between $120-$160 per hour, with most residential projects taking 8-40 hours to complete depending on complexity.

A basic system typically includes smart lighting controls, a programmable thermostat, voice control integration (Alexa/Google), and basic security features like smart locks or doorbell cameras. Installation usually takes 8-15 hours and costs between $1,000-$3,000 total.
Certified home automation technicians in Los Angeles typically charge $120-$160 per hour for standard installations, with specialized programming and integration work commanding $140-$220 per hour depending on complexity and technician expertise.
Yes, many systems have monthly monitoring fees ($10-$50), cloud service subscriptions, and periodic maintenance costs. Security monitoring typically costs $20-$40 monthly, while advanced automation features may require $10-$25 monthly subscriptions.
Complete whole-home automation installations typically require 25-40 hours of labor over 3-7 days, depending on home size and system complexity. This includes device installation, network setup, programming, testing, and user training.
The biggest cost drivers are home size, existing infrastructure limitations, integration complexity, and equipment quality. Older homes often require electrical upgrades or new wiring, while premium commercial-grade equipment can double system costs compared to consumer devices.
